Bill Overview

Title: Transparency for Malign Chinese Investments in Global Port Infrastructure Act

Description: This bill requires the Office of the Director of National Intelligence to submit a report to Congress documenting all Chinese investment in port infrastructure globally since January 1, 2012, and the commercial and economic implications of such investments.

Sponsors: Rep. Wenstrup, Brad R. [R-OH-2]
